Subject: DR drill next Thursday — Parcelhawk webhook

Hi all, welcome aboard! Quick heads-up for the new folks: Thursday's disaster-recovery drill simulates losing the Parcelhawk webhook relay that feeds carrier scan events into Dispatchly. Your job is to fail over to the Tornquist standby region and replay the missed deliveries. The failover console will ask you to confirm with the relay's recovery passphrase, which is noted below.

strongbox words: oliix-praax

## Formula Sandbox

The Vexalit API evaluates user-supplied formulas inside an isolated Karvel runtime. No network, filesystem, or clock access. Execution caps: 250ms CPU, 16MB memory. Violations return HTTP 422 with a `sandbox_breach` code. On-call: if breach rates spike, disable the `formula.eval` flag via the ops endpoint and page platform. All sandbox admin calls require elevated auth. When invoking the kill-switch endpoint during an incident, authenticate with the following token.

session JWT of yawep-yawep = eyJhbGciOiJIUzI1NiIsInR5cCI6IkpXVCJ9.eyJzdWIiOiI3pWF3_In0.aXYsHiog

Telemetry payloads from Brennick agents must be zstd-compressed before release sign-off. Uncompressed builds inflate ingest costs and trip the size gate in staging. Check the build flag telemetry_compress=on in every release candidate; the gate will not catch sidecar payloads. Verification takes two minutes per build. The step-by-step verification checklist is on the internal page here.

operations page: https://confluence.qorvellabs.internal/pages/projects/projects/projects

Team assistants at Wrenfield Gate should note that the evacuation-chair store on each landing must remain unobstructed and its contents checked monthly against the posted inventory card. Visitors with mobility needs must be logged at sign-in so a trained operator can be assigned. The store cabinet is locked at all times; to open it during drills or emergencies, use the code below.

staff pass of kawip-hawef = bdg-QLP-2